The Quirky Gift Exchanges Within the Royal Family
Christmas in the royal family wouldn’t be complete without the customary gift exchange, which, over the years, has seen its share of humor and surprises. One of the more amusing stories involves Prince Harry gifting his grandmother, the Queen, a cheeky shower cap with the phrase, “Ain’t life a b***h.” Princess Anne also added her own flair by gifting King Charles a unique leather toilet seat cover. These lighthearted moments offer a glimpse into the playful side of royal life, showing that even in the most prestigious family, humor plays an important role.

A Humorous Gift from Early Days of Romance

The early days of Prince William and Kate’s relationship were marked by trial and error, especially when it came to choosing the perfect gifts. Prince William humorously recalled one such moment during an appearance on Peter Crouch’s BBC Radio Five Live podcast. “In the early days of our relationship, I gave Kate a pair of binoculars as a present. That’s something she will never let me forget. It wasn’t my finest hour.” While it may not have been the most romantic gift, it’s a charming reminder of how far their relationship has evolved over the years.
